I used the circuit same as on the datasheet CS6422. But in my case I did not use any of the control pins (DATA,STROBE,DRDY,RSET) instead I put pull up resistor for RSET (50K from 5VDC). From the very first I connect it to telephone handset while calling. Then I pull down the RSET pin then it was working. I even place the other handset (my caller) very close and no more howling. Acoustic echo was totally removed. After, around 5mins we stop the call. Then call again, I repeat my steps as what I did before but audio theres no audio on the outputside of both path. I scope the inputs, at pin NI theres an audio signal same with APO when i speak to my mic. But on there outputs, NO and AO no audio signal. What is wrong is the ship worn out? Please explain further why I cant have the audio on the outputs.?
